Last nite i decided to watch a show i had recorded. The show lasted about 45 minutes & after it was over i deleted it & then i seen that i wanted to watch the beginning of the show that was on the channel i left it on while watching my recorded show. BUT when i tried to rewind the channel it would not go back. I thought when you had it on a channel it was ALWAYS recording that channel, even if i am watching a taped show as long as it is on the channel it's recording. I know thats how the HDDVR worked i had from TWC, but this HR20 700 i know nothing about. Any help is appreciated. Thanks

IF you change the channel to check something else you WILL lose the buffer for the channel you were watching, so in a sense, NO it's not actually recording. keep in mind that you can record two different channels and still watch something you already have recorded. Jimbo |
